DETAILS:
At the top of the Player Support Post will be one top level comment for bugs and errors, and another top level comment for player questions. Player Support mod is responsible for answering any questions players ask in the latter.
Player Support also handles requests from Inactive players to be listed as Active again. A returning player needs to still have their activity log and inventory intact to be eligible for reactivation.
To edit a player's active status, on the sidebar of the staff portal, you'll choose Dashboard >> People >> Members. From there, go to the Inactive tab. Find the player you need to edit, and click the green gear button on the right side of their row. In the edit page you'll find a dropdown menu to change the player's status.
Players can also submit new level badge sets at Player Support, and can spend vouchers to change their website icon. These things have to be change by a website admin, so you'll pass these updates along to Website Updates.
Try to keep up to date with Player Support at least once a week.
Important! I have found that editing in Rich Text Editor breaks the forms box that players need to copy their forms from.
To prevent this, ONLY edit in Casual HTML mode.
